Do car headlights run out of light?
Car headlights don’t “run out of light” like batteries do, but their brightness and performance will gradually degrade over time until they no longer meet safety needs. This phenomenon is called Lumen Depreciation. The specific causes and countermeasures are as follows:
1. Causes and lifespan of lumen depreciation 1. Lumen depreciation rate of different light sources Headlight type Average lifespan Lumen depreciation threshold (brightness drops to 70% of initial value) Halogen bulb 500–1,000 hours About 500 hours (15% depreciation per year) Xenon lamp (HID) 2,000–3,000 hours About 2,000 hours (5% depreciation per year) LED headlight 15,000–30,000 hours About 15,000 hours (1–3% depreciation per year)
Halogen bulb: Filament evaporation causes glass to blacken, and brightness drops by 10���20% per year.
Xenon lamp: electrode loss and gas impurities lead to reduced light efficiency.
LED: chip aging, poor heat dissipation or driver circuit failure cause light decay.
2. Intuitive manifestation of light decay
Shortened irradiation distance: LED headlights originally designed to illuminate 100 meters may only reach 60-70 meters after 5 years.
Color temperature shift: HID lamps may change from 5,000K cold white to 4,200K warm yellow, reducing road contrast.
Beam scattering: lampshade oxidation or internal reflective bowl coating peeling, resulting in scattered light (brightness perception decreases by 30-50%).
2. Common factors that accelerate light decay
High temperature environment:
Halogen bulbs have an operating temperature of 250℃, and long-term high temperature accelerates filament evaporation.
Poor LED heat dissipation (such as aftermarket modified parts) will cause the chip temperature to exceed 120℃ and shorten the life by 50%.
Voltage fluctuation:
Unstable voltage in the vehicle circuit (such as generator failure) will make the arc of the HID bulb unstable and accelerate electrode loss.
Physical damage:
Scratches and fogging of the lampshade (transmittance drops from 90% to 60%).
Failure of the seal causes water to enter the interior and corrosion of the reflector bowl (loss of brightness by 40%).
III. How to determine whether the headlights need to be replaced
Professional test:
Use a Lux Meter to measure the headlight intensity. If it is less than 1,000 lumens (low beam), it needs to be replaced (GB 4599 requirements).
At night, check whether the light spot is uniform and whether there is a dark area at a distance of 10 meters.
Self-test method:
Wall projection method: Aim the headlight at the wall in a dark place and observe whether the light pattern is clear (if the light and dark cutoff line is blurred, maintenance is required).
Comparison test: Compare the brightness difference with the same model headlights of new cars.
IV. Solution 1. Regular maintenance
Clean the lampshade: Polish with UV sealant (such as 3M 39008) every 6 months to restore light transmittance.
Check the circuit: Make sure the voltage is stable (halogen lamp: 12.8–14.4V; LED: 9–16V).
2. Upgrade options
LED replaces halogen: Choose a model with optimized thermal management (such as Philips X-tremeUltinon, with a life of 25,000 hours).
Replace the assembly: The original headlight assembly (such as Toyota original LED) can restore 95% of the original performance.
3. Economical repair
Reflector bowl refurbishment: Electroplating repair (cost about ¥200–500/piece), suitable for old cars.
Replacement of aftermarket headlights (such as TYC brand) costs 30% of the original cost.
V. Regulations and safety tips
Annual inspection requirements: China GB 7258 stipulates that the low beam brightness must be ≥ 800 lumens, otherwise it is considered unqualified.
Safety risks: Headlights with severe light decay will increase the night accident rate by 40% (NHTSA data).
Summary: The headlights will not suddenly "lose light", but the performance will gradually decline with time and use. It is recommended to check the light decay every 2 years and replace or repair it in time when the brightness is below the safety threshold. Give priority to original or well-reputed brand accessories to avoid secondary light decay caused by cheap modified parts.

Why Crisis Management is Crucial for Your Brand's Survival and Success
In an age where news spreads like wildfire, particularly through social media, brands face the constant threat of a crisis. The reputational risks are higher than ever before, and the response time to manage any crisis has become critically short. Brands that have a crisis management strategy in place can mitigate damage more effectively and safeguard their hard-earned reputation. Without such preparedness, businesses risk losing consumer trust and market position.
Importance of crisis management
Protecting brand reputation
A brand’s reputation is its most valuable asset, and a crisis can severely damage it. Without a strong crisis management plan, negative news can spread quickly, diminishing public trust. A well-executed strategy ensures timely communication and helps mitigate damage by addressing issues transparently. Brands that are proactive in handling crises tend to retain consumer loyalty and trust even in the most challenging times.
Minimizing financial loss
Beyond reputational damage, crises can lead to significant financial loss. A poorly managed crisis can drain a company's resources, whether through legal liabilities, loss of business, or brand devaluation. An effective crisis management plan helps businesses control the narrative and address financial concerns swiftly, minimizing the long-term economic impact.
Maintaining consumer confidence
Consumer trust is hard to earn but easy to lose. During a crisis, customers expect brands to be transparent, accountable, and quick to resolve issues. Brands that manage crises effectively are more likely to retain consumer loyalty, while those that fail to respond in time may experience a long-term decline in customer engagement.
Ensuring business continuity
A crisis doesn’t just affect a brand’s public image—it can disrupt operations, halt projects, and affect employee morale. Crisis management includes planning for continuity to maintain or restore business functions during and after a crisis. This ensures that a brand can recover and remain competitive even under pressure.

Pistols The CZ 75 The Member Of Famous "The Wonder 9" Is Here CZ75 is a semi-automatic pistol made by Česká zbrojovka Uherský Brod (CZUB) in the Czech Republic. First introduced in 1975, it is one of the original "wonder nines" featuring a staggered-column magazine, all-steel construction, and a hammer forged barrel. It has a good reputation amongst pistol shooters for quality and versatility at a reasonable price, and is widely distributed throughout the world. It is also the most common gun in the Czech Republic.
We Covering 4 Famous Version of this Gun which are CZ75B (Second-generation CZ 75 with internal firing pin safety, squared and serrated trigger guard, and ring hammer. which fire in Semi Auto Mode), CZ75A (The Machine Pistol Version of CZ75, That Popularized by Grand Theft Auto 4:The Lost And Damned & Counter Strike:Global Offensive), CZ SP01 (New generation of CZ 75 SP-01 pistol especially adapted according to suggestions as proposed by users from Law Enforcement, Military and Police communities worldwide, with an additional input from the Team CZ shooters Angus Hobdell and Adam Tyc. Based on the SP-01, it has no firing pin block resulting in improved trigger travel. It also features a slightly reshaped grip and safety, a “weaker” recoil spring for easier loading, and fiber optic front sight and tactical “Novak style” rear sight.) & CZ P-07 (The CZ P-07 DUTY is a compact, polymer-framed CZ 75 variant notable for having a redesigned trigger mechanism. The redesign has reduced the number of parts as well as improved the trigger pull. Chambered in 9mm Luger and .40 S&W, the CZ P-07 DUTY also includes the ability to change the manual safety to a decocking lever and vice versa through an exchange of parts.)
ASSAULT Rifles 1.SA Vz-58 Assault Rifle The Samopal vzor 1958 (submachine gun, model of 1958) was the standard assault rifle of the Czechoslovak army from the late 1950s and until the dissolution of the Socialist Republic Of Czechslovakia in the 1993. At the present time the SA Vz.58 is still used by the Czech and Slovak armies, as well as sold for export in some quantities. The SA Vz.58 saw not much of real combat, so it is hard to judge how it stakes up against the most known contemporary rivals, like the Soviet / Russian AK-47 or the US M16. But the overall quality, fit and finish of this rifle is excellent. This rifle had been designed by the Czech arms designer Jiří Čermák, under the project codename "KOŠTĚ", or "Broom", in English. Development began in January 1956, and the rifle was adopted for service only 2 years later, in 1958. The rifle was manufactured by the state-owned arms factory "Česká zbrojovka", located in the town of Uherský Brod (CZ-UB).
The Czech army planned to replace the SA Vz.58 with the newest CZ-2000 and the CZ-805 rifle system, chambered for 5.56mm NATO ammunition, but the financial difficulties severely slowed down this process.
While SA Vz.58 strongly resembles externally the famous Kalashnikov AK-47 assault rifle, but internally it is entirely different and of original and well-thought out design. We Covering 2 Famous Version of this Gun which are Vz. 58 P which is Standard fixed stock (casually called "pádlo" (paddle) by Czech soldiers) & Vz. 58 V: Metal folding stock version for vehicle crew and airborne units. (casually called "kosa" (scythe) by Czech soldiers) 1.CZ-805 BREN Assault Rifle The CZ 805 assault rifle was first introduced to the public in 2009, as a possible future replacement for aged SA Vz-58 assault rifles still in use by Czech Armed Forces. According to the recent news, early in 2010 the CZ 805 was selected as a next standard military rifle for Czech armed forces, with production contract issued to the famous Czech arms factory CZ-UB in the city of Uhersky Brod. The CZ 805 assault rifle is of modular, multi-caliber design, with aluminum alloy upper receiver and polymer lower receiver / fire control unit. The magazine housing is a separate detachable unit, which can be replaced in the field in the course of caliber change. CZ 805 also features quick-change barrels, allowing to change calibers and barrel lengths according to the mission profile (in each caliber there there are short carbine barrel, standard barrel and long "marksman" or "squad automatic" barrel). The basic action uses fairy common piston-operated gas action with manual gas regulator, and a rotating bolt locking. For each proposed caliber, there is a separate bolt with appropriate dimensions. Fire control unit includes ambidextrous safety/fire selector switch, which permits single shots, 2-round bursts and full automatic fire. Charging handle can be installed on either side of the gun, depending on user preferences. Feed is from detachable box magazines, which are inserted into detachable magazine housing. In standard configuration, the CZ 805 will use proprietary 5.56x45 caliber 30-round magazines made of translucent polymer. Other magazine housings will allow use of Standard STANAG AR Magazine or H&K G36 5.56mm magazines, as well as various 7.62X39 Soviet M43 and 6.8x43 magazines. CZ 805 assault rifle is fitted with integral Picatinny rail on the top of receiver, with additional rails running on the sides and the bottom of the forend. Rifle will be issued with folding iron sights, and will also accept a wide variety of additional sighting equipment (red-dot or telescope day sights, night sights, lasers etc.). Rifle is equipped with side-folding buttstock, which is adjustable for length of pull, and can be completely removed if maximum compactness is required. Additional equipment also includes new, specially designed 40mm underbarrel grenade launcher CZ G 805 and also a new knife-bayonet. Sub Machine Guns 1.SA VZ.23 The CZ Model 25 (properly, Sa 25 or Sa vz. 48b/samopal vz. 48b – samopal vzor 48 výsadkový, "submachine gun model year 1948 para") was perhaps the best known of a series of Czechoslovak designed submachine guns introduced in 1948. There were four generally very similar submachine guns in this series: the Sa 23, Sa 24, Sa 25, and Sa 26. The primary designer was Jaroslav Holeček (September, 15 1923–October, 12 1997), chief engineer of the Česká zbrojovka Uherský Brod arms factory. Despite The Weapon was SA.26 which fired 7.62×25mm Tokarev. it basically still a same gun despends on Storytelling 2.Škorpion vz. 61 The Škorpion vz. 61 is a Czechoslovak 7.65 mm submachine gun developed in 1959 by Miroslav Rybář (1924–1970) and produced under the official designation Samopal vzor 61 ("submachine gun model 1961") by the Česká zbrojovka arms factory in Uherský Brod. Although it was developed for use with security forces and special forces, the weapon was also accepted into service with the Czechoslovak Army, as a personal sidearm for lower-ranking army staff, vehicle drivers, armored vehicle personnel and special forces. We Covering 2 Famous Version of this Gun which are Famous Vz. 61 which chambered in .32 ACP & Vz. 68 Which Chambered with more popular 9mm Cartridge, despite the First was more popular than former. 3.Scorpion EVO 3 is a 9mm submachine gun manufactured by Česká zbrojovka Uherský Brod. The EVO 3 designation denotes that the firearm is a third generation of CZ's line of small submachine guns started by the Škorpion vz. 61. Skorpion Evo 3 evolved from a Slovakian prototype submachine gun called the Laugo. Chambered in 9×19mm Parabellum, the Scorpion EVO 3 is a light weight, compact submachine gun designed to be easily maneuvered in constrained spaces. The A1 variant features a select fire switch, giving the operator the choice of 'safe,' semi-automatic, three-round burst, or fully automatic fire, while the S1's switch only features 'safe' and semi-automatic fire. The standard version comes equipped with a folding, adjustable and fully removable stock for easy transport. The hand guard is lined with multiple Picatinny Rails for the addition of attachments such as grips, sights, flashlights and lasers.
